MEXICAN MAN INVOLVED IN COCAINE DRUG DISTRIBUTION RING IS GOING TO PRISON

Date:

Raymundo Villarreal, 22, of Newton, N.C. was a multi-kilogram level distributor of methamphetamine, cocaine and marijuana, operating mainly out of North Carolina and Tennessee.

On October 16, 2019 Raymundo was sentenced to eight years in prison and 5 years of supervised release for his role in the drug conspiracy.

From 2014 until August 2018, Raymundo was part of a drug distribution ring responsible for trafficking methamphetamine, cocaine and marijuana in Western North Carolina, centered in and around Catawba County. The conspiracy extended well beyond North Carolina to Tennessee, Georgia, Texas, California, Illinois, Mexico and elsewhere.

The drug operations involved the trafficking of multi-kilogram quantities of narcotics. There were also several other defendants that received heavy sentencing enhancements for their possession of firearms during the drug conspiracy.
